BROKEN CLUTCH!!!!!
« on: 16 July 2011, 18:13:29 »

What else can be wrong?
While taking my gearbox out to fix my slave cylinder, I have found two broken cats a destroyed reliese bearing and slave cylinder AND when I got the clutch out, the straps on the pressure plate were all broken!! Never seen that before?

Re: BROKEN CLUTCH!!!!!
« Reply #2 on: 17 July 2011, 12:51:40 »

This happened to mine. Original VX part. Only done about 135k  :). Flywheel was very worn. (to much play) Think this had something to do with it. Also had trouble changing from 1st to 2nd. put second hand box in new clutch and a flywheel from a 65k engine.
Still a bit clunky from 1st to second but much better than before.
